All about undefined

Interested in learning more?

  • 793202 992136 589

    29 16674 131880809

    See more
  • 668321590 0468 662339

    1493816158 0272894809 35143 89495109

    See more
  • 3583163414 93457

    4811330 546681808 03525808016 39

    See more